Foundation Overview

Based in Greenwood Village, CO, Tappan Easton Foundation has awarded 83 grants totaling $533,000 to organizations in Colorado, Kansas and 5 other states across the US. Individual grants range from $600 to $25,000, with a median award of $5,000.

Form 990-PF Research Tips
  • Review Part XV for detailed grant recipient information and funding purposes
  • Check Part I for total assets, annual giving amounts, and payout requirements
  • Examine Part VIII for key personnel compensation and board structure
  • Look for trends across multiple years to understand giving patterns
